## Quick start
|
||||
|
||||
If you are running on a Linux-based system, you can get up and running quickly with the quickstart script, like so: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
composer require silverstripe/fulltextsearch && vendor/bin/fts_quickstart
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This will:
|
||||
|
||||
- Install the required Java SDK (using `apt-get` or `yum`)
|
||||
- Install Solr 4
|
||||
- Set up a daemon to run Solr on startup
|
||||
- Start Solr
|
||||
- Enable `FulltextSearchable` in your `_config.php` (and create one if you don't have one)
|
||||
|
||||
The simply adding `$SearchForm` to a template and flushing the template cache should add a search text box to your site.
